Understanding Mesotherapy
Mesotherapy is a non-surgical cosmetic treatment that involves injecting a mixture of vitamins, minerals, and other medications into the mesoderm, the middle layer of skin. This procedure is used to address various skin concerns such as cellulite, fat reduction, and skin rejuvenation. Frequency of Mesotherapy Sessions
The frequency of mesotherapy sessions can vary depending on the individual's skin condition, the area being treated, and the specific goals of the treatment. Generally, a series of sessions is recommended to achieve optimal results. For most patients, a session every two to four weeks is typical. However, this can be adjusted based on the progress and feedback from the practitioner.
Factors Influencing Treatment Frequency
Several factors can influence how often you should get mesotherapy in Waterford:
- Skin Condition: Patients with more severe skin issues may require more frequent treatments initially, followed by maintenance sessions.
- Treatment Area: Larger areas or areas with more pronounced issues may necessitate more frequent sessions.
- Individual Response: Some individuals may respond more quickly to the treatment, allowing for longer intervals between sessions.
- Health and Lifestyle: Factors such as overall health, diet, and exercise can impact the effectiveness and frequency of mesotherapy.
Maintenance and Long-Term Benefits
Once the desired results are achieved, maintenance sessions are usually recommended to sustain the benefits of mesotherapy. These maintenance sessions can range from every few months to once a year, depending on the individual's needs and the advice of the practitioner. Regular maintenance helps to keep the skin looking fresh and healthy, prolonging the effects of the initial treatment series.

FAQ
Q: How long do the effects of mesotherapy last?
A: The duration of the effects can vary, but many patients experience noticeable improvements for several months to a year.
Q: Is mesotherapy painful?
A: Most patients report minimal discomfort. The procedure involves tiny injections, and topical anesthetics can be used to reduce any potential pain.
Q: Are there any side effects of mesotherapy?
A: Common side effects include temporary redness, swelling, and bruising at the injection site. These usually resolve within a few days.
Q: Can mesotherapy be used for all skin types?
A: Yes, mesotherapy is suitable for most skin types. However, it is essential to consult with a professional to ensure it is appropriate for your specific skin condition.
